Common EKS Cost Challenges We Solve
Most teams waste 40-70% of their EKS budget. Here's how we fix it.
Problem: Paying for idle EC2 capacity
Solution: Right-size node groups based on actual utilization
Problem: Missing Spot Instance savings
Solution: Automated spot adoption with graceful interruption handling
Problem: Overprovisioned pod resources
Solution: AI-driven resource recommendations based on usage data
Problem: No visibility into team costs
Solution: Namespace-level cost allocation with AWS billing integration

EKS-Specific Cost Optimization Features
Purpose-built features for Amazon EKS cost management.
EC2 Node Right-Sizing
Identify overprovisioned EC2 instances in your EKS node groups. Get recommendations for optimal instance types based on actual workload demands.
Spot Instance Automation
Safely migrate stateless workloads to EC2 Spot Instances with automatic fallback. Save up to 90% on compute costs with intelligent spot management.
Pod Resource Optimization
Analyze CPU and memory requests/limits for every pod. Eliminate waste from overprovisioned containers while maintaining performance.
Cost Allocation by Namespace
Track costs by namespace, team, or environment with accurate AWS billing integration. Enable chargeback and showback for engineering teams.
Savings Plans Analysis
Get recommendations for Compute Savings Plans based on your EKS usage patterns. Maximize reserved capacity discounts.
Cluster Autoscaler Optimization
Fine-tune Karpenter or Cluster Autoscaler settings for cost-efficient scaling. Balance performance with cost optimization.
